用户
 找回密码
 入住 CI 中国社区
搜索
查看: 3531|回复: 4
收起左侧

[HELP] utf-8和gb2312的问题

[复制链接]
发表于 2009-8-27 15:57:15 | 显示全部楼层 |阅读模式
我以前写asp的,如果文件不存为utf-8格式的话,即便文件中写了"content="text/html; charset=utf-8",也肯定会出现乱码.

而现在用dreamweaver打开ci的文件,发现都是gb2312格式.
用记事本打开ci的文件,发现都是ansi格式.

我的网页数据库肯定都要用utf-8的,但ci源文件都是gb2312的话,那我在views\models\controllers中写的文件到底该存成什么格式呢????


编码问题可能是一个很弱的问题.但始终百思不得其解,求解
发表于 2009-8-27 16:19:12 | 显示全部楼层
utf-8
发表于 2009-8-27 16:22:12 | 显示全部楼层
编码问题要说很简单,全部都统一,不管是源码,还是数据库,还是 HTML,这是一个永不变的真理。

但是,你要知道一点,没有中文的页面是不分编码的,也就是说纯英文的文件没有编码问题,必须输入中文以后再指定是什么编码。
 楼主| 发表于 2009-8-27 17:12:24 | 显示全部楼层
感谢二位
发表于 2009-8-28 14:32:55 | 显示全部楼层
UTF8的好处,是显而易见的。
版主的,所有的都统一,是真理。

本版积分规则